Early Life and Excessive Faculty

Rebecca Lobo was born on October 6, 1973 in Hartford, Connecticut to lecturers RuthAnn and Dennis. She has German and Irish ancestry on her mom’s aspect and Cuban ancestry on her father’s aspect. Lobo has a brother named Jason and a sister named Rachel, each of whom additionally performed basketball. Raised in Southwick, Massachusetts, Lobo attended Southwick Regional Faculty, the place she set a faculty basketball workforce document with 2,740 complete factors.

Collegiate Profession

Recruited by over 100 faculties, Lobo elected to attend the College of Connecticut. She was an prompt star participant on the Huskies girls’s basketball workforce, successful Huge East Freshman of the 12 months honors in 1992. In 1994, Lobo was named Huge East Participant of the 12 months and Most Excellent Participant of the Huge East Match. She concluded her profession at UConn in extraordinary trend in 1995, serving to the Huskies obtain an undefeated season en path to their first-ever nationwide championship title. Lobo gained a surfeit of honors for her senior season. Along with being named the Most Excellent Participant of the NCAA event, AP Participant of the 12 months, Naismith Faculty Participant of the 12 months, WBCA Participant of the 12 months, and USBWA Nationwide Participant of the 12 months, she gained the Honda Sports activities Award, the Honda-Broderick Cup, and the Wade Trophy.

United States Nationwide Staff

Lobo first performed for the US girls’s basketball workforce in 1992 on the FIBA Beneath-18 Girls’s Americas Championship in Mexico. There, the workforce gained a silver medal. Lobo then performed for the Beneath-19 workforce in 1993. In 1996, she was a member of the US workforce that gained gold on the Summer time Olympics in Atlanta.

WNBA Profession

In 1997, Lobo joined the WNBA for its inaugural season. Assigned to the New York Liberty, she made her debut in a victory over the Los Angeles Sparks in June. Lobo completed the common season with career-high averages of 12.4 factors and seven.3 rebounds per sport. The Liberty went on to succeed in the first-ever WNBA Finals, the place they misplaced to the Houston Comets. Within the 1998 season, Lobo averaged 11.7 factors and 6.9 rebounds in a career-high 30 video games and 30 begins. She had a significant setback in 1999 after struggling a knee damage within the first sport of the season, ruling her out for the remainder of the season. Lobo re-injured her knee on the finish of the 12 months and ended up lacking everything of the 2000 season. She returned in 2001 however solely performed a complete of 85 minutes throughout 16 video games.

After enjoying with the NWBL’s Springfield Spirit within the 2002 WNBA offseason, Lobo was traded to the WNBA’s Houston Comets within the spring of 2002. In her sole season with the Comets, she averaged 1.6 factors and 1.1 rebounds in 21 video games. Throughout the 2003 WNBA offseason, Lobo once more performed with the Springfield Spirit. She was subsequently traded by the Comets to the Connecticut Solar, with which she averaged 2.4 factors and a pair of.1 rebounds in 25 video games in 2003. Lobo helped the Solar attain the playoffs, the place they made it to the Japanese Convention Finals in opposition to the Detroit Shock. The Solar in the end misplaced 73-79. After that, Lobo introduced her retirement from the WNBA.

Well being Advocacy and Charity

In 1996, Lobo and her mom co-authored the e-book “The House Staff” about her mom’s battle with breast most cancers. The pair additionally created a scholarship for Hispanic college students on the UConn Faculty of Allied Well being. Moreover, Lobo served because the 1996 spokesperson for the Lee Nationwide Denim Day fundraiser, which raises cash for breast most cancers analysis and wellness packages. In 2000, Lobo turned a nationwide spokesperson for Body1.com, a community of internet sites providing interactive details about medical applied sciences. Due to her recurring knee points, she has been energetic in elevating consciousness of knee accidents in girls.

Broadcasting Profession

Lobo serves as a basketball reporter and analyst for ESPN, specializing in each WNBA video games and girls’s school basketball. She additionally co-hosts the weekly podcast “Ball & Chain” along with her husband.

Private Life

In 2003, Lobo married sportswriter and novelist Steve Rushin on the Basketball Corridor of Fame. Collectively, they’ve three daughters and a son.
